The Cost of Wellbore Problems

• Stuck Pipe

• Kick

• Lost Circulation

• Sloughing Shale

• Flows

• Wellbore Instability

• 41% of total NPT• US $8B+ Annually

James K. Dodson Co. 1993-2002 Year NPT Analysis

(Offshore, Jan 2004)

Case-1 Environment

• Deepwater Well offshore Trinidad

• Significant uncertainty in subsurface environment

• High potential for unscheduled events related to uncertainty

• Need for real-time geomechanics modeling

• Operator domain expert is not offshore deployable resource

• Unplanned requirement ~ low budget & short fuse

Case-1 Installation

• Baker Hughes Inteq installed WITSML v1.2 server in Port of Spain

• <30 Minutes in BP Houston Offices

– Installed Drillworks ConnectML on client PC

– IP Address, UN, Pass, Configuration for server connection

– Configure Drillworks data links to ConnectML

– Expert begins modeling using real-time data

– Expert activates WITSML server to make interpretation

available to rig

Lessons Learned

• WITSML updates slower than WITS

– Internet time versus direct cable time

• Concurrent use of proprietary system (Riglink, Interact) aids in

monitoring data dead zones

• System is still imperfect, and requires companies to collaborate on

problems

• WITSML must be planned before a project.

– Connections attempted as after thoughts have failed.
